Southeastern Train Services Disrupted by Blocked Line
A fallen tree has blocked the railway at Eltham. Southeastern train services were hit after the obstruction. Trains from Eltham towards Dartford cannot run.
Impact on local services
Services on the Bexleyheath line are being delayed by up to 30 minutes. Some journeys have been cancelled. Other trains are being rerouted via the Woolwich or Sidcup lines.
Alternative travel and ticketing
Passengers are advised to allow extra time when travelling. National Rail Live Departures boards should be checked before journeys begin.
London Buses will accept rail tickets between Lewisham and Dartford. Routes via Welling are included at no extra cost.
Updates and communications
Disruption is expected to continue until around 6pm. National Rail confirmed a tree is blocking the line at Eltham and warned of cancellations and revisions.
